How Motion Sensors Work

Motion sensors operate on various technologies, primarily passive infrared (PIR), microwave, and dual technology. PIR sensors detect changes in infrared radiation, which is emitted by moving objects, such as people or animals. Microwave sensors, on the other hand, emit microwave pulses and measure the reflection off moving objects. Dual technology combines both PIR and microwave sensors to minimize false alarms, ensuring that the lights activate only when necessary. This is particularly useful in areas with frequent wildlife activity or where environmental factors might trigger a false alarm.

The effectiveness of these sensors is influenced by several factors, including the sensor’s range, angle of detection, and sensitivity settings. Most downward firing lights allow users to adjust these parameters, tailoring the system to suit specific needs and environments. For instance, in a residential setting, homeowners might prefer a shorter detection range to avoid unnecessary activation from passing cars, while a larger commercial space may require a broader detection area to ensure comprehensive coverage.

Benefits of Downward Firing Lights

One of the primary advantages of downward firing outdoor motion sensor lights is their ability to provide targeted illumination. This focused lighting reduces light pollution, ensuring that only the desired areas are illuminated. Furthermore, these lights can enhance safety by illuminating pathways, driveways, and entry points, deterring potential intruders. The downward angle of illumination also minimizes glare, making it easier for people to navigate outdoor spaces without being blinded by excessive brightness.

Another significant benefit is energy efficiency. Many modern downward firing lights utilize LED technology, which consumes less energy and has a longer lifespan compared to traditional incandescent bulbs. This efficiency not only reduces electricity bills but also minimizes the frequency of bulb replacements. Additionally, some models come with solar-powered options, allowing for even greater energy savings and sustainability. These solar lights harness sunlight during the day and provide illumination at night, making them an eco-friendly choice for environmentally conscious consumers. With advancements in smart technology, some downward firing lights can even be integrated into home automation systems, allowing users to control lighting remotely and customize settings based on their preferences.

Installation Considerations

Installing downward firing outdoor motion sensor lights requires careful planning to maximize their effectiveness. Factors such as location, height, and angle of installation play crucial roles in ensuring optimal performance.

Choosing the Right Location

When selecting a location for installation, consider areas that require illumination, such as entrances, garages, or pathways. It is essential to position the lights where they can effectively detect motion without obstructions, such as trees or walls. Additionally, installing lights near high-traffic areas enhances security and visibility. For instance, placing lights near driveways not only helps in guiding vehicles safely at night but also deters potential intruders who might be lurking in the shadows. Furthermore, consider the proximity to windows or doors; lights that are too close may trigger unnecessarily, while those too far away might not provide adequate coverage.

Height and Angle of Installation

The height at which the lights are installed significantly impacts their performance. Typically, mounting the lights between 8 to 12 feet above the ground is recommended. This height allows for a broad coverage area while minimizing the risk of tampering. It’s also vital to ensure that the lights are not installed in a way that they can be easily blocked by vehicles or outdoor furniture, as this could hinder their ability to detect movement effectively.

The angle of the light should also be adjusted to ensure that the beam covers the intended area. Downward firing lights should be angled slightly downward to maximize their effectiveness in illuminating pathways and entry points. Additionally, consider the surrounding environment; for example, if the area experiences heavy snowfall or rain, angling the lights to avoid direct exposure to these elements can prolong their lifespan and maintain functionality. Regularly checking the alignment and performance of the lights after installation can help in making necessary adjustments and ensuring they continue to operate optimally throughout the seasons.

Maintenance and Care

regular maintenance is essential to keep downward firing outdoor motion sensor lights functioning optimally. This includes cleaning the fixtures, checking the sensor’s sensitivity, and ensuring that the light bulbs are in good working condition. Neglecting these tasks can lead to decreased performance and may even result in complete failure of the lighting system, leaving your outdoor spaces inadequately illuminated and less secure.

Cleaning and Upkeep

Over time, dirt, dust, and debris can accumulate on the light fixtures, diminishing their brightness. Cleaning the lenses and housing with a soft cloth and mild detergent can restore their effectiveness. It is advisable to perform this maintenance periodically, especially in areas prone to dust or pollen. Additionally, inspecting for any signs of corrosion or wear around the fixtures can help identify potential issues before they escalate. If the lights are installed in particularly harsh environments, such as coastal areas with salty air or regions with heavy snowfall, more frequent cleaning and upkeep may be necessary to ensure longevity.

Testing Sensor Functionality

Regularly testing the motion sensor’s functionality ensures that it responds appropriately to movement. This can be done by walking within the sensor’s range and observing if the light activates. Adjustments may be necessary if the sensor fails to detect movement or activates too frequently. It’s also beneficial to familiarize yourself with the sensor’s settings, as many models offer adjustable sensitivity levels and time delays. Understanding these features allows you to customize the lighting to suit your specific environment, reducing false triggers from passing cars or animals while ensuring adequate illumination when you need it most. Furthermore, consider the placement of the sensor; positioning it away from direct sunlight or strong winds can enhance its performance and reliability.

Energy Efficiency and Sustainability

As energy efficiency becomes increasingly important, downward firing outdoor motion sensor lights offer a sustainable lighting solution. The integration of LED technology not only reduces energy consumption but also contributes to a lower carbon footprint.

LED Technology Advantages

LED lights are known for their longevity, often lasting up to 25 times longer than traditional incandescent bulbs. This durability translates to fewer replacements and less waste, making them an environmentally friendly choice. Additionally, LEDs emit less heat, further enhancing their energy efficiency.

Smart Lighting Integration

Many modern outdoor motion sensor lights can be integrated into smart home systems. This allows homeowners to control their lighting remotely, set schedules, and receive notifications when motion is detected. Such features not only enhance convenience but also provide an additional layer of security.

Challenges and Solutions

While downward firing outdoor motion sensor lights offer numerous benefits, they are not without challenges. Understanding these challenges and implementing effective solutions can lead to a more satisfactory lighting experience.

False Alarms

One common issue with motion sensor lights is false alarms triggered by animals, moving branches, or other non-threatening movements. To mitigate this, homeowners can adjust the sensitivity settings of the sensor or install the lights in locations less prone to such disturbances.

Limited Detection Range

Another challenge is the limited detection range of some motion sensors. Homeowners may find that the lights do not activate when someone approaches from an unexpected angle. To address this, selecting lights with adjustable detection angles or multiple sensors can enhance coverage and performance.
